The Nature of the Inner Self

The Moon in Pisces places the individual in a state of constant emotional permeability. This sign is ruled by Neptune, the planet associated with dreams, the unconscious mind, spirituality, and the dissolution of boundaries. Consequently, the Pisces Moon person does not merely experience emotions; they absorb them. Their feelings are tender and sit just beneath the surface, making them highly reactive to the environment. A sad commercial, a beautiful piece of art, or a sweet memory can instantly trigger a deep emotional response. This sensitivity is not a weakness but a heightened state of perception. They possess an emotional intelligence that allows them to read facial expressions and body language with uncanny accuracy, often knowing what others are thinking before a word is spoken.

The inner world of the Pisces Moon is described as "ethereal" and "dreamy." Unlike the more logical and grounded signs, this personality type lives in a realm where reality and imagination dance in endless harmony. They are often dreamers and idealists, possessing a strong connection to the spiritual or "other side" of existence. This manifests as an interest in the unknown, ghosts, mythology, or the mystical aspects of life. Their emotional needs are deeply tied to beauty, compassion, and creative expression. They are not driven by materialistic comforts but by the pursuit of meaning, purpose, and emotional connection.

Vulnerabilities and Emotional Challenges

Despite their profound strengths, the Pisces Moon personality carries inherent vulnerabilities rooted in their extreme sensitivity. Because they are so receptive to the feelings of others, they often lose themselves in the problems and emotions of those around them. This can lead to a state of emotional overwhelm where the boundary between self and other becomes blurred. The tendency to suppress their own needs to please others is a common pitfall. While their generosity is a strength, it can become unhealthy if it leads to self-neglect.

The influence of Neptune, while enhancing creativity, also introduces a tendency toward escapism or addiction. When faced with the harshness of reality, the Pisces Moon individual may retreat into a dream world, fantasy, or substances to cope with the emotional intensity. This "ethereal" quality can make it difficult for them to maintain a firm grip on practical realities. They may struggle with the need to define their own sense of purpose, as their nature is so focused on the needs of others that their own path can become obscured.

In terms of interpersonal dynamics, their soft-hearted nature can make them targets for those who wish to exploit their compassion. The Pisces Moon person must learn to establish healthy boundaries to prevent being drained by the emotional demands of others. They often go through a period of "trial and error" in relationships, searching for a partner who understands their depth.

Romantic Dynamics and Compatibility

In matters of the heart, the Pisces Moon sign is defined by a desire for total union. They love to fall in love and are often attracted to the depth and mystery in others. When in a relationship, they do not merely take on an individual; they aim to intertwine lives completely, often wanting to do everything together. They view their partner as part of a larger community or "family." Their approach to love is characterized by a willingness to sacrifice and a desire to be a source of support.

Compatibility for the Pisces Moon is often found with signs that can anchor their fluid nature while respecting their emotional depth. * Virgo: There is a notable compatibility with Virgo. Virgos are often described as "onions" with many layers to discover, which the imaginative Pisces Moon finds fascinating. The partnership is mutually beneficial; the Pisces Moon helps the Virgo open up emotionally and learn to trust, while the Virgo provides structure and grounding for the Pisces. * Scorpio: The Pisces Moon is also often attracted to Scorpio. They are fascinated by the Scorpio balance of a hard exterior and a soft interior. However, this relationship requires work, as Scorpio can be controlling. The Pisces Moon must learn where not to compromise to ensure the relationship functions healthily.

Conversely, the Pisces Moon may struggle with signs that are less emotional. Air signs like Gemini and Aquarius, and fire signs like Aries and Leo, tend to be more logical and less emotional. This difference in processing the world can create conflict, as the Pisces Moon's sensitivity clashes with the logical or aggressive nature of these signs.
